Output 42607142a06a5421bbea1980587f0c7d04d6b00392011b97ff3b4d3b470bb428:0

value
4068000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ed95df47d441e27b9e69efa6a9092cce19e44208 OP_EQUAL
address
3PMFcJveJ56dPGeDPpDGNBLrS4rf8AYQo8
transaction
42607142a06a5421bbea1980587f0c7d04d6b00392011b97ff3b4d3b470bb428
spent
true